Understanding Customer Needs
The first step in developing customer loyalty is to understand the needs and preferences of your customers. Conduct market research to identify their pain points, desires, and expectations. By understanding your customers, you can tailor your products, services, and interactions to meet their needs effectively. This includes personalized communication, addressing customer feedback, and continuously improving your offerings based on customer insights.
Exceptional Customer Service
Providing exceptional customer service is essential for building customer loyalty. Customers appreciate prompt, helpful, and empathetic support. Train your employees to be knowledgeable, courteous, and responsive to customer inquiries and concerns. Implement a customer service strategy that focuses on resolving issues quickly and efficiently, and ensure that customers feel valued and appreciated throughout their journey with your brand.
Creating a Unique Customer Experience
A unique and memorable customer experience can significantly impact customer loyalty. Go beyond the basic expectations and create an experience that stands out from your competitors. This can be achieved through innovative product features, engaging marketing campaigns, or exceptional in-store experiences. By offering a unique value proposition, you can differentiate your brand and keep customers coming back for more.
Implementing a Loyalty Program
A loyalty program is a powerful tool for developing customer loyalty. Reward customers for their repeat purchases, referrals, or engagement with your brand. Offer exclusive discounts, early access to new products, or special events for your loyal customers. Make sure your loyalty program is easy to understand and participate in, and provide tangible benefits that encourage customers to keep coming back.
Engaging with Customers Through Social Media
Social media platforms provide an excellent opportunity to engage with customers and build relationships. Create a strong online presence by actively participating in conversations, sharing valuable content, and showcasing your brand’s personality. Encourage customer feedback and make an effort to respond to their comments and inquiries promptly. By engaging with your customers on social media, you can foster a sense of community and loyalty.
Continuous Improvement and Innovation
To maintain customer loyalty, it’s essential to continuously improve your products, services, and customer experience. Stay updated with market trends and customer preferences, and be willing to adapt and innovate. Collect customer feedback regularly and use it to make informed decisions. By showing that you are committed to delivering the best possible experience, you can reinforce customer loyalty and encourage long-term relationships.
